TotalyMeow wrote:
biskvito wrote:When you start the logout make the player drop whatever object they're carrying over the head, so it won't consume yellow bile if there's a disconnection or crash.


We added the 'can't just drop it' mechanic specifically so that people couldn't log out in shallow water and destroy things like skeletons that shouldn't be destroyable, or move things in ways they shouldn't be able to like dropping them off the edges of cliffs.
